Trial begins for 3 Tacoma officers charged in death of Manny Ellis

Jury selection started Monday in the trial of three Tacoma police officers charged in the death of Manuel "Manny" Ellis, a 33-year-old Black man who was tackled, punched, shocked with a stun gun and held face down on a sidewalk in March 2020, two months before George Floyd met a similar fate.

Man files excessive force claim against 2 Tacoma officers

Two Tacoma police officers involved in the death of Manuel "Manny" Ellis have been accused of wrongfully arresting and using excessive force in an unrelated incident three months before their fatal encounter with Ellis.

2 new officers identified in death of Manuel Ellis

At least two new law enforcement officers have been identified as having participated in restraining Manuel Ellis, a Black man who died after his airways were restricted in March.
